PowerTools SPREAD for ASP.NET 8.0J
SetTag メソッド (DefaultSheetDataModel)

モデル内のセルの行インデックス
モデル内のセルの列インデックス
設定する値
指定した行と列のセルにアプリケーション定義のタグ値を設定します。
構文
'Declaration
 
Public Overrides Sub SetTag( _
   ByVal row As Integer, _
   ByVal column As Integer, _
   ByVal value As Object _
) 
public override void SetTag( 
   int row,
   int column,
   object value
)

パラメータ

row
モデル内のセルの行インデックス
column
モデル内のセルの列インデックス
value
設定する値
次のサンプルコードは、指定した行および列のセルにアプリケーション定義のタグ値を設定します。
dataModel = FpSpread1.ActiveSheetView.DataModel; 
dataModel.AddCustomName("TWICESUM", "2*SUM(A1,A2)", 1, 1); 
dataModel.AddCustomName("TWICEPRODUCT", "2*A1*A2", 2, 2); 
FpSpread1.ActiveSheetView.SetFormula(1, 1, "TWICESUM"); 
FpSpread1.ActiveSheetView.SetFormula(2, 2, "TWICEPRODUCT"); 
FpSpread1.ActiveSheetView.SetValue(0, 0, 10); 
FpSpread1.ActiveSheetView.SetValue(1, 0, 10);
dataModel.SetTag(2, 2, "TWICEPRODUCT"); 
dataModel.RemoveCustomName("TWICESUM")
dataModel.Recalculate(); 
Dim dataModel As New FarPoint.Web.Spread.Model.DefaultSheetDataModel
dataModel = (FarPoint.Web.Spread.Model.DefaultSheetDataModel)FpSpread1.ActiveSheetView.DataModel
dataModel.AddCustomName("TWICESUM", "2*SUM(A1,A2)", 1, 1)
dataModel.AddCustomName("TWICEPRODUCT", "2*A1*A2", 2, 2)
FpSpread1.ActiveSheetView.SetFormula(1, 1, "TWICESUM")
FpSpread1.ActiveSheetView.SetFormula(2, 2, "TWICEPRODUCT")
FpSpread1.ActiveSheetView.SetValue(0, 0, 10)
FpSpread1.ActiveSheetView.SetValue(1, 0, 10)
dataModel.SetTag(2, 2, "TWICEPRODUCT")
dataModel.RemoveCustomName("TWICESUM")
dataModel.Recalculate();
参照

DefaultSheetDataModel クラス
DefaultSheetDataModel メンバ
GetTag メソッド

 

 


© 2003-2015, GrapeCity inc. All rights reserved.